On Sat, Apr 01, 2006 at 05:14:43PM +0100, David Allsopp wrote:
> Has anyone successfully compiled bindings for PostgreSQL under Windows XP?
> I'm using OCaml 3.09 (MinGW binaries, Cygwin installed) and PostgreSQL 8.1.3
> running locally but am having no joy trying to compile
> postgresql-ocaml-1.5.0
You could try PG'OCaml. It might be better, because it's pure OCaml,
so requires no external libs. However it still builds using Makefile
(GNU make) so you might need to adapt the relatively simple build
system to use whatever works on Windows.
